Today's card is all about those first signs of SPRING ... when the daffodils start popping up out of the ground! LOVE when I see that happening ... lets me know Winter is almost in the rear view mirror! LOL
Today I've used the Altenew Build-a-Garden Daffodil Delight stamp set. I didn't purchase the dies that went with this set so after coloring with Tombow markers, I fussy cut and popped up my daffodils onto a VERY old design paper that I spotted in my stash. I'm sure it was purchased long ago at JoAnn's.
A few orange Nuvo crystal drops were used as an accent.
